What does fresh fall morning candle smell like?
Fresh Fall Morning has a touch of autumnal citrus blended with sage and apples; scent-wise, it’s a tad more on the masculine side.

What does teakwood smell like?
Teakwood is a bold, woodsy fragrance. It is a complex scent that appeals to a wide range of people, but most tend to think of it as a masculine scent. It has a rich, warm, and slightly spicy aroma you need to smell for yourself to completely appreciate. Reminiscent of cologne, it has a pleasant earthy aroma.
What kind of candles are Bath and Body Works?
There are two main types of wax Bath & Body Works uses for their candles: vegetable and paraffin. (We’ll talk more about paraffin in a minute.) What is this? Apparently, the brand’s “Signature Collection Candles” are paraffin-free and contain a blend of vegetable and soy wax.

How would you describe the smell of fall?
That brisk, crisp, slightly sharp smell we associate with autumn is actually the smell of leaves, trees, and plants dying and rotting. The memories we associate with the change of seasons are what make it pleasurable, even when many of us are allergic to moldy leaves and burning wood.

Are you supposed to light all 3 wicks?
If you decide to burn just one wick at a time, still do the first burn with all three wicks — then alternate between wicks for the single burns, so that you keep the level of wax more or less even across the surface of the candle.
Why cant I smell my Bath and Body Works candle?
To troubleshoot the problem, first try burning your candle in a smaller room, such as a bathroom or home office, in case the scent is simply subtler than expected. Also, try burning your candle for a longer period of time, as it may simply need a full melt-pool to diffuse the scent.
